Output 80ba39518f31805c5d004f5e8335d711d72c29ccf31b8917920be88e27a64fa6:1
- value
- 11573675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d758e893ffb2c286110b77456fe17c202903c55e OP_EQUAL
- address
- 3MKfiFxgUKaNXDLez2P8zG55mHoFrYXuZS
- transaction
- 80ba39518f31805c5d004f5e8335d711d72c29ccf31b8917920be88e27a64fa6